Noam Chomsky: Imperial Grand Strategy

Plot: In two lectures and a 45-minute interview, intellectual and political activist Noam Chomsky -- credited as the father of modern linguistics -- delivers an unabashed criticism of the Bush administration's record on terrorism, framing the president's invasion of Iraq as part of an "imperial grand strategy. " Filmed in 2003, this collection of Chomsky's personal views also provides an effective overview of the global political climate
